Revelation 14:12

Here is the patience of the saints: here are they that keep the commandments of God, and the faith of Jesus.

KJV

ὧδε ἡ ὑπομονὴ τῶν ἁγίων ἐστίν, οἱ τηροῦντες τὰς ἐντολὰς τοῦ θεοῦ καὶ τὴν πίστιν Ἰησοῦ.

Greek NT

Hic patientia sanctorum est, qui custodiunt mandata Dei, et fidem Jesu.

Vulgate

Here is the patience of the saints, they that keep the commandments of God, and the faith of Jesus.

ASV

Here is the patience of the saints, who keep the commandments of God and the faith of Jesus.

Douay-Rheims
